Noel
Noel
Born: 1995-10-11 in New York, New York, U.S
Showing 1 to 9 of 9 results
Noel
Sharknado 2: The Second One
Bleed for This
Rocky's
Light My Fire
In the Shadowlands
After School
Bad News on the Doorstep
Interference
Showing 1 to 9 of 9 results